Jugular Response : Identification and Medical Significance
The hepatojugular phenomenon is a identification tool used to evaluate proper cardiac filling . It’s usually assessed by applying constant force to the right area to obstruct hepatic venous and observing the subsequent rise in jugular vein pressure . A significant elevation (>4 cm H2O) in jugular vein during this maneuver indicates elevated central venous pressure , potentially reflecting diseases such as heart failure, cardiac effusion , or vena cava obstruction . Therefore, recognizing the hepatojugular reflex and its abnormal results is essential for precise assessment and management of patients with possible heart and vascular impairment .

Hepatobiliary Cancer: Advancements in Discovery and Therapy
Significant breakthroughs are being made in the realm of hepatobiliary disease, particularly concerning its early discovery and therapy . Previously challenging to pinpoint due to often subtle symptoms and ambiguous imaging, novel methodologies are now available. These include enhanced MRI , computed tomography scans, and increasingly, liquid biopsies which examine circulating tumor material for early indicators . Management options have also grown, with targeted therapies and immunotherapies showing improved results for some people. Surgical resection remains a key option for appropriate candidates, often combined with other therapies like systemic chemotherapy or ablation. Furthermore, research continues to focus on personalized treatment , tailoring strategies to the unique characteristics of each malignancy .

Organ Supplements: Do They Really Work?
The rapidly growing market for organ support formulas promises protection against hepatic damage, but do these assertions hold true ? Many individuals are looking for natural ways to support organ health , especially given the prevalence of conditions like fatty liver disease . While what is hepatoburn used for some components found in these supplements , such as silymarin extract, root, and dandelion root , have indicated promise in limited research, the total evidence remains unclear. Often , the studies are small , poorly designed, or lack standardized controls . It's vital to remember that liver-protective formulas are not a alternative for medical advice and must be used under the direction of a qualified medical professional . Think about discussing any concerns about organ health with your healthcare provider before taking any formulas.
